Aesthetic outcomes of facial reconstruction after skin cancer resection (RSCR) may affect long-term quality of life.
We evaluated postoperative patient perceptions of skin cancer defect reconstruction using patient-reported outcome measures.
Patients who underwent RSCR from 2016 to 2021 completed validated FACE-Q scales, including Satisfaction with Facial Appearance (SFA), Scar Appearance, and Appearance-Related Distress (ARD). Scores were scaled 0–100 and compared.
